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i vs Parnaiba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i, Usa and Parnaiba, Brazil is approximately 6,783 km or 4,215 mi.
  • To reach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i in this distance one would set out from Parnaiba bearing 325.2°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i bearing 307.9° or NW .
  •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Parnaiba has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Parnaiba is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 19.7 °C (35.5°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 25.1 °C (45.2°F) more in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 613.1 mm (24.1 in) less which is equivalent to 613.1 l/m² (15.05 US gal/ft²) or 6,131,000 l/ha (655,445 US gal/ac) less. About 3/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.1° lower in Big Rapids Waterworks, Mi than in Parnaiba.
